Centrifugal pumps are widely used in various industries for transferring liquids from one place to another. The efficiency of a centrifugal pump is crucial in determining the amount of power required to achieve a specific flow rate and pressure. Calculating the mechanical power needed for a centrifugal pump involves considering factors such as flow rate, pressure, and efficiency.
